Forestland — Area — FAO TIER 1 in Malawi
Malawi: Forestland — Area — FAO TIER 1 was 2,032 1000 ha in 2025. ▼ Falling
Forestland — Area — FAO TIER 1 in Malawi, 1990–2025
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in 1000 ha.
Analysis
Malawi recorded 2,032 1000 ha for forestland — area — fao tier 1 in 2025. That is the lowest value across all 36 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 2.0% on the previous year and down 17.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, forestland — area — fao tier 1 in Malawi peaked at 3,502 1000 ha in 1990 and was at its lowest, 2,032 1000 ha, in 2025.
Malawi ranks 114th of 239 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 36 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 3,313 1000 ha | 3,124 1000 ha | 3,502 1000 ha | 10 |
| 2000s | 2,893 1000 ha | 2,704 1000 ha | 3,082 1000 ha | 10 |
| 2010s | 2,473 1000 ha | 2,284 1000 ha | 2,662 1000 ha | 10 |
| 2020s | 2,137 1000 ha | 2,032 1000 ha | 2,242 1000 ha | 6 |

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ions from Forests consists of CO2 emissions and removals corresponding to forest carbon stock changes (aboveground and belowground living biomass). Estimates are computed following the 2006 IPCC Guidelines for National Greenhouse Gas Inventories (IPCC, 2006).
